About CRENSHAW EL AND MIDDLE

Set in PORT BOLIVAR, Texas, CRENSHAW EL AND MIDDLE is a rural-scale elementary school, one of the schools within GALVESTON ISD. It caters to 131 students across grades pre-K through 8. That puts it 75% below the typical public school in Texas, which averages around 519 students.

Within GALVESTON ISD, which oversees 14 schools and 7,662 students, CRENSHAW EL AND MIDDLE is one campus in the system.

In terms of who attends, CRENSHAW EL AND MIDDLE shows that the most-represented group is White (53%), with the rest of the student body spread across multiple groups. Other groups include 41% Hispanic, 2% Black, 2% multiracial.

On the resource side, Staff filings list 16 full-time-equivalent teachers, which works out to roughly 8.0:1 students per teacher. That figure is tighter than the state norm's 15.1:1 average. An estimated 77% of students are eligible for free or reduced-price lunch, a commonly cited indicator of low-income enrollment. By comparison, Galveston County runs at roughly 57%, so the school's eligibility rate is somewhat above the surrounding baseline.

On a demographically-adjusted basis, CRENSHAW EL AND MIDDLE tracks the demographic baseline. The model predicts 40.2% given the school's FRL share; actual proficiency is 43.4%.

Around the school, the surrounding county (Galveston County) records that median household earnings sit near $86,105, about 35% of the adult population holds a bachelor's degree or above, and census figures put the poverty rate at about 9%. CRENSHAW EL AND MIDDLE is one of 95 public schools in Galveston County (combined enrollment of about 62,767 students).

The closest other public school is ROSENBERG EL LABORATORY FOR LEARNING AND LEADING, roughly 9.9 miles away. On composite proficiency, CRENSHAW EL AND MIDDLE comes 2nd of 7 in the immediate cluster, higher than the nearby-schools average of 39.3%.

Geographically, the school is in a countryside area.

Five-year trend. CRENSHAW EL AND MIDDLE's enrollment has contracted 16% since 2018, when it stood at 156 (now 131). Class-load math has pulled in: from 11.8:1 in 2018 to 8.0:1 in 2025.
